Slab installation services involve preparing and pouring concrete to create durable, level surfaces for various outdoor areas. This process typically includes site preparation, which involves clearing the area, leveling the ground, and ensuring proper drainage. Once the site is ready, a professional contractor will pour and finish the concrete to create a smooth, even surface. These services are essential for constructing patios, driveways, walkways, and other flat outdoor spaces that require a solid foundation.

This service helps address common problems such as uneven or cracked surfaces, poor drainage, and unstable ground that can cause safety hazards or property damage. Over time, concrete slabs may settle or develop cracks due to soil movement or weather conditions. Replacing or repairing these slabs with new, properly installed concrete can improve the safety and appearance of outdoor spaces, preventing further deterioration and reducing maintenance needs.

The overview below groups typical Slab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Elmhurst, IL.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- For minor slab repairs or crack filling,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, depending on the extent of the damage and slab size.

Standard Installations - Replacing or installing new slabs for typical residential patios or walkways usually costs between $1,500 and $3,500. Most projects in Elmhurst and nearby areas tend to land in this middle range.

Large or Complex Projects - Larger, more intricate installations such as driveways or custom-designed slabs can range from $4,000 to $8,000 or more. Fewer projects push into this high-tier pricing unless involving extensive customization or difficult access.

Full Replacement - Complete removal and replacement of an existing slab often costs between $5,000 and $10,000+, depending on size and site conditions. Many full replacements are at the higher end of this spectrum due to labor and material costs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When comparing contractors for slab installation projects in Elmhurst, IL, it’s important to consider their experience with similar types of work. Homeowners should inquire about how long a service provider has been handling slab installation and ask for examples of past projects comparable in scope and complexity. A contractor with a proven track record in residential slab work can offer insights into their familiarity with local soil conditions, common challenges, and best practices, helping ensure the project is completed efficiently and to expectations.

Clear, written expectations are essential when selecting a service provider for slab installation. Homeowners should seek detailed proposals that outline the scope of work, materials to be used, and specific responsibilities. Having this information in writing helps prevent misunderstandings and provides a basis for evaluating bids. Reputable contractors will be transparent about their process and willing to discuss project details, ensuring that all parties are aligned before work begins.

Effective communication and reputable references are key indicators of a reliable contractor. Homeowners are encouraged to ask for references from previous clients who had similar projects completed. Speaking with past customers can provide insights into the contractor’s professionalism, punctuality, and quality of work. Additionally, choosing a service provider that demonstrates open, prompt, and clear communication throughout the initial consultation can foster a smoother project experience.
